Blackout Blinds: The Best Way To Darken Your Room

By


Blackout Blinds are transformative. If you close them, they will block every bit of light from a room even if it is in the middle of day. If you have ever spent time in a luxury hotel, you know that blackout blinds are a big part of the experience. They let you sleep in total darkness even if it is late in the day!

Blackout blinds also have home uses. Imagine any room in which you may want darkness at any time where there is daylight outside. You will want room darkening blinds where there is a child’s room and afternoon napping requires darkness. You will want room darkening blinds where total darkness will enhance watching a movie at home. And, of course, sleeping in on a weekend would not be the same without blackout blinds. Moreover, blackout blinds also help block noise out of your room to ensure a restful night’s sleep.

If you are considering blackout blinds, decide what options you want. If you choose a routed blind, it will have holes in each slat through which the slats are strung together. If you choose a routless blind, the slats will ladder on each other. Routed slats have holes in them through which light may infiltrate your room. The solution for this is to choose stylish cloth tapes to cover your slat holes so that you have complete blackout in your room.


You should always keep the main purpose of blackout blinds in mind. If they do not keep out the light, they are not worthwhile. But blackout blinds also have a secondary insulation quality. In other words, they are energy efficient and you are doing something positive for the environment by purchasing them. Blackout blinds will help keep unwanted heat out of your home in the hot months and will help keep wanted heat in your home in the cold months. Blackout blinds provide good insulation because they trap dead air between their slats. In addition to their energy efficient insulation, room darkening blinds will help stop solar radiation from damaging your furniture.

Internal blackout blinds, or blinds-between-glass, is one option you should give serious thought. Internal blinds are blinds that are sealed between double pane or triple pane windows. Blackout blinds are often not perfect because light can infiltrate where the blinds do not fit perfectly against the windows. But internal blinds are precisely fitted against the windows at the factory. There is zero risk of a gap between the blinds and the window.

Moreover, internal blackout blinds have other advantages as well. Because they are encased in glass, they will remain perpetually clean and will never be pushed out of place. The cord will never be a hazard to your children or to your pets.
